Output 43af94d60b095cb8c91570d11432f8c790060179775858a0ed89f767c4f2a520:21

value
10000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6251d087ede14203af53d10a72c0d28777d0f5c8 OP_EQUALVERIFY OP_CHECKSIG
address
19xsENngRkGyJAD3DAknnBcF3DUy8esPY9
transaction
43af94d60b095cb8c91570d11432f8c790060179775858a0ed89f767c4f2a520
spent
true